FRAMINGHAM, MA - Access Framingham invites Framingham residents to an Open House from 1:00-5:00pm on Saturday, November 10th, 2012. All are welcome!
Access Framingham is located at the rear of the Fuller Middle School, at 31 Flagg Drive in Framingham, MA.
As part of the festivities, attendees can record a free DVD with holiday wishes for family and friends, and/or record a holiday greeting from your family to be telecast on AF-TV’s cable channels and website.

FRAMINGHAM, MA -- Framingham's School Superintendent, Dr. Steven Hiersche and School Committee Chairman Adam Blumer; and Townwide PTO President Kristin Romine will appear on The Audrey Hall Show discussing the School Reorganization Initiative in Framingham.
The discussion centers around the thinking behind the proposal and the strategic approach to change.
